![]() ТОР 5 статей: Методические подходы к анализу финансового состояния предприятия Проблема периодизации русской литературы ХХ века. Краткая характеристика второй половины ХХ века Характеристика шлифовальных кругов и ее маркировка Служебные части речи. Предлог. Союз. Частицы КАТЕГОРИИ:
|
Сортировка выбором;В куче будет распределено одно целое число, равное 11. 13. На алгоритме разделении массива на две части, где любой элемент первой части меньше любого элемента второй части, основан алгоритм быстрой сортировки 14. В худшем случае, трудоемкость ~N^2 имеют алгоритмы быстрая сортировка, сортировка выбором, шейкерная сортировка 15. Для алгоритма линейного поиска верно, что его трудоемкость в сренем ~N и его трудоемкость в лучшем случае ~1 16. После выполнения фрагмента программы S:= ‘цугрка’; Insert(‘лу’, s, 3); Цулугрка 17. Содержимое текстового файла text.txt после выполнения фрагмента программы, если изначально он содержал текст ‘Turbo’ assign(f,'text.txt'); rewrite(f); write(f,'pascal'); close(f); Pascal 18. Структура данных, в которой каждый элемент, кроме последнего связан со следующим: односвязный список 19. Функция, возвращающая размер файла: FileSize 20. Преобразует число в строку функция Str 21. Процедура, создающая файл, если он существует, и усекающая файл до нулевой длины если он существует; а затем открывающая его для записи: rewrite 22. В среднем случае, трудоемкость ~N*Log(N) имеют алгоритмы пирамидальной сортировки, быстрой сортировки 23. Type PNode = ^TNode; TNode = record d: integer; n: integer; end; var p, h: TNode; k: integer; begin h:=nil; repeat(k); new(p); p^.d:=k; p^.n:=h; h:=p; until k = 0; p:=h; k:=1; while p <> nil do begin if k mod 2 = 1 then write (p^.d); k:=k + 1; p:= p^.n; end; end. 24. Удаление объекта из динамической памяти выполняет процедура dispose 25. Дан текстовый файл ‘num.txt’ следующего содержания: 1 48 2 3 -1 5 8 0 9 4 В результате выполнения программы var f: text; i, s:integer; begin assign(f, 'num.txt'); reset(f); s:=0; while not eof(f) do begin while not eoln(f) do read(f,i); readln(f); s:=s+1; end; write(s); close(f); end. На экран будет выведено число 2 26. Дан текстовый файл ‘num.txt’ следующего содержания: 1 48 2 3 -1 5 8 0 9 4 В результате выполнения программы var f: text; i:integer; begin assign(f, 'num.dat'); reset(f); while not eoln(f) do read(f, i); readln(f); read(f, i); write(i); close(f); end. На экран будет выведено число 8 27. В результате выполнения фрагмента программы S:= ‘кукушка’; S1:= ‘рок’; Delete(s, 3, 5); Insert(s1, s, 3); Значение переменной s= курок 28. Функция, возвращающая текущую позицию курсора(указателя) файла – filepos 29. Функция, возвращающая признак конца строки в текстовом файле… EOLN 30. Тип «указатель на целое число» описывается так: ^integer 31. Хэш таблицу, организованную способом закрытого хеширования, естественно реализовать с помощью массива односвязных списков 32. Преобразует строку в число процедура val 33. Формат описания текстового файла … VAR ИМЯ_ФАЙЛОВОЙ ПЕРЕМЕННОЙ:TEXT 34. Содержимое текстового файла text.txt после выполнения фрагмента программы, если изначально он содержал текст ‘Turbo’ Assign(f, ‘d:\text.txt’); Append(f); Write(f, ‘Pascal’); Close(f); TurboPascal 35. В результате выполнения фрагмента программы var f:file of integer; i:integer; begin assign(f,'text.txt'); rewrite(f); i:=5; write(f,i); close(f); reset(f); read(f,i); write(filepos(f)); close(f); end. На экран будет выведено число 1 36. Для реализации какой структуры данных лучше всего подходит структура «пирамида» («куча») очередь с приоритетами 37. Для выделения памяти в куче используется процедура new 38. Структура данных, работающая по принципу «Первый пришел – первый ушел»: очередь 39. Структура данных, по принципу «приходите все и в любом порядке, но в первую очередь уходят (обрабатываются) самые приоритетные: очередь с приоритетами 40. В результате выполнения фрагмента s:=copy('крокодил',4,3); s:=’ код ’ 41. Хэш таблицу, организованную способом открытого хеширования, естественно реализовать с помощью массива челых чисел 42. Структура данных, в которой на каждый элемент, кроме одного (это корень), ссылается в точности на один другой элемент – дерево 43. Функция, возвращающая текущую позицию курсора(указателя) файла – filepos(f) 44. Функция, возвращающая признак конца файла – EOF 45. Хеш-таблицу целых чисел, организованную способом открытого хеширования, естественно реализовать с помощью массива целых чисел 46. В результате выполнения фрагмента программы s:=length('крокодил'); значение переменной s:= 8 47. В результате выполнения фрагмента программы s:='кукушка'; s:=copy(s, length(s) div 3, length(s) mod 4); s:=’ уку ’ 48. В среднем случае, трудоёмкость N^2 имеют алгоритмы: Сортировка выбором; Не нашли, что искали? Воспользуйтесь поиском:
|